DESCRIPTION

Born out of Chevrolet\'s all-in assault on late-1960s Trans-Am racing, the 1969 Camaro Z/28 stands as one of the most purpose-built street machines of the muscle car era. With fewer than 21,000 produced for the model year, real-deal Z/28s have always lived in rarified air, especially those retaining their correct components and factory attitude.

Under the cowl induction hood lives the legendary DZ-coded 302ci V8, a high-winding small block engineered to dominate road courses and embarrass big-inch rivals. Backed by a proper 4-speed manual and topped with ceramic coated long tube headers, this setup delivers the kind of mechanical soundtrack that defined an era when revs mattered more than displacement.

Finished in aggressive red and sitting on classic 15-inch Rally wheels, this Camaro carries the unmistakable Z/28 look with front and rear spoilers and a purposeful stance. Manual steering keeps the connection raw and honest, while power brakes and an aluminum radiator make it street-ready without dulling the edge.

Inside, the black and white houndstooth bucket seat interior is pure 1969 performance Chevrolet. A center console with gauges, factory clock, and Hurst shifter remind you this car was built for drivers, not spectators. Every detail reinforces its identity as a factory-built weapon.

This is a real X33 Z/28 with a date-code-correct engine, the kind of Camaro that serious collectors and hardcore drivers chase. It is not just a muscle car, it is a homologation legend that helped cement the Camaro as a road-racing icon.
